1. Office Administration & Remote Reception
Virtual front office Search for remote office administrator, receptionist, and front office coordinator positions that handle calls and basic inquiries. These roles often include updating records and supporting daily operations without needing to be on‑site.
2. Research, Survey & Market Research Support
Remote research work Search for research assistant and market research assistant roles that help collect and analyze information. Tasks like surveys, desk research, and reporting are usually handled through online tools.
3. Audio Editing, Podcast Production & Voice Work
Remote audio work Seek audio editor, podcast producer, and voice talent positions that support podcasts and audio content. Recording and editing can be done from a home studio using standard software and equipment.
4. QA Testing & Quality Assurance
Remote QA testing Search for QA tester, software tester, and quality assurance engineer roles that check products for bugs and issues. These positions often use test plans and reporting tools that make remote work straightforward.
5. Data Entry & Data Processing
Remote data entry Target titles like data entry clerk, data processor, and records clerk where the main work is entering and updating information. Many organizations with large databases offer fully remote positions focused on accuracy and speed.
6. Systems & Network Administration
Remote systems admin Seek systems administrator and network administrator roles that monitor and maintain servers, networks, and cloud environments. Many organizations allow this work to be done remotely using secure access tools.
7. HR Generalist, Recruiter & Talent Sourcer
Remote HR & hiring Seek recruiter, talent sourcer, and HR generalist roles that manage hiring pipelines and employee support online. Interviews, onboarding, and many HR processes now run through remote‑friendly tools.
8. Compliance, Risk & Regulatory Support
Remote compliance work Target compliance analyst and risk analyst roles that track policies and review accounts for potential issues. This type of work often uses shared documents and case systems that are accessible remotely.
9. Customer Service & Call Center Support
Remote customer support Seek remote roles like customer service representative, call center agent, and chat support with companies that rely heavily on phone or online support. These employers often hire fully remote staff to handle customer questions and basic troubleshooting.
10. Virtual Assistant & Executive Assistant
Remote admin support Look for roles such as virtual assistant, administrative assistant, and executive assistant that support busy professionals and small teams online. These jobs usually involve managing calendars, inboxes, documents, and simple coordination tasks from home.
